After my initial problems installing SP1, NavMan were d*mn prompt in e-mailing me the full .exe SP1 - which installed perfectly.



These are what I've noticed so far with SP1!



* The GPS Status screen, no longer has the counter moving in the bottom left when getting a fix - but does get much faster fixes for me now. (NavMan 3000 + 3630)



* The Red Line on routing now has little green arrows all over it, to indicate direction of travel



* The Dark green manoeuvre arrow, is not light green - and changes to dark green once you've moved over it



* I've travelled about 800 miles with SP1, and I haven't once been told to keep right on UK Motorways - finally I now know how long I'm going to be on the motorway for!



* Routing is VASTLY improved, it now takes the routes I know are quicker, instead of its rather annoying diversions



* Not sure if this is new, but you can double tap on the top information line on the routing screen, and it will automatically re-calculate the route for you (very useful!)



* Previously, numerous POI's couldn't be routed too, because they weren't on the road - i've tested some of these, and I seem to be able to set them as destinations now - instead of just getting an error



* New Speaking Lady takes some getting used to, especially when she says "at the roundabout" as she starts off speaking quietly, and the voice increases in volume. But is vastly improved, and seems to be able to output more accurate distances than just a few simple distance numbers

(You do have to choose the new voice from the setup, as it stayed with the old voice originally for me after the upgrade)



* When reaching a destination, you no longer have to reach the end of the red line before its officially the destination, she calls the destination about 100 feet before it now (roughly) and cancels your route, so SmartST isn't constantly re-routing you.





The above are my initial findings of SP1 - and so far I've been very impressed. My only major critisim of the Upgrade is I no longer know if anything is happening on the GPS Status screen (but GPS fixes are much improved).

Kam,



Automatic rerouting isn't the same as recalculating the route from scratch, I believe. With auto rerouting it appears to try quite hard to get you back onto the originally set route; sometimes it has wanted me to backtrack up to four or five miles to do this. Recalculating from scratch appears to erase the original route and therefore doesn't have this backtracking effect.

Actually, I think the automatic cancellation of route when the destination is reached is a disaster.



The feature (in the original release) was BRILLIANT when I found myself in a busy city center, routing to a Hotel, but being unable to park/find anywhere to park. I was able to "go around" 3 or 4 times - with the software automatically re-routing me back to my original destination via all the one-way streets, or being taken off in directions I did not want to go by the traffic flow, all without the worry of having to remember how to try and get back to my destination!

This was fantastic and I could not stop telling friends what a good feature it was! Now it's gone...



A retrograde step from my point of view.
